src/platform/redox/redox-exec/src/arch/x86.rs

@@ -0,0 +1,70 @@
+use syscall::error::*;
+
+use crate::{FdGuard, fork_inner};
+
+// Setup a stack starting from the very end of the address space, and then growing downwards.
+pub(crate) const STACK_TOP: usize = 1 << 31;
+pub(crate) const STACK_SIZE: usize = 1024 * 1024;
+
+/// Deactive TLS, used before exec() on Redox to not trick target executable into thinking TLS
+/// is already initialized as if it was a thread.
+pub unsafe fn deactivate_tcb(open_via_dup: usize) -> Result<()> {
+    let mut env = syscall::EnvRegisters::default();
+
+    let file = FdGuard::new(syscall::dup(open_via_dup, b"regs/env")?);
+
+    env.fsbase = 0;
+    env.gsbase = 0;
+
+    let _ = syscall::write(*file, &mut env)?;
+    Ok(())
+}
+
+pub fn copy_env_regs(cur_pid_fd: usize, new_pid_fd: usize) -> Result<()> {
+    // Copy environment registers.
+    {
+        let cur_env_regs_fd = FdGuard::new(syscall::dup(cur_pid_fd, b"regs/env")?);
+        let new_env_regs_fd = FdGuard::new(syscall::dup(new_pid_fd, b"regs/env")?);
+
+        let mut env_regs = syscall::EnvRegisters::default();
+        let _ = syscall::read(*cur_env_regs_fd, &mut env_regs)?;
+        let _ = syscall::write(*new_env_regs_fd, &env_regs)?;
+    }
+
+    Ok(())
+}
+
+#[no_mangle]
+unsafe extern "cdecl" fn __relibc_internal_fork_impl(initial_rsp: *mut usize) -> usize {
+    Error::mux(fork_inner(initial_rsp))
+}
+
+#[no_mangle]
+unsafe extern "cdecl" fn __relibc_internal_fork_hook(cur_filetable_fd: usize, new_pid_fd: usize) {
+    let _ = syscall::close(cur_filetable_fd);
+    let _ = syscall::close(new_pid_fd);
+}
+
+//TODO
+core::arch::global_asm!("
+    .p2align 6
+    .globl __relibc_internal_fork_wrapper
+    .type __relibc_internal_fork_wrapper, @function
+__relibc_internal_fork_wrapper:
+    ud2
+
+    .size __relibc_internal_fork_wrapper, . - __relibc_internal_fork_wrapper
+
+    .p2align 6
+    .globl __relibc_internal_fork_ret
+    .type __relibc_internal_fork_ret, @function
+__relibc_internal_fork_ret:
+    ud2
+
+    .size __relibc_internal_fork_ret, . - __relibc_internal_fork_ret"
+);
+
+extern "cdecl" {
+    pub(crate) fn __relibc_internal_fork_wrapper() -> usize;
+    pub(crate) fn __relibc_internal_fork_ret();
+}
